기계 번역으로 제공되는 번역입니다. 제공된 번역과 원본 영어의 내용이 상충하는 경우에는 영어 버전이 우선합니다.
사용자 배경 세션
사용자가 더 이상 활성 상태가 아니더라도 사용자 백그라운드 세션은 계속됩니다. 이렇게 하면 사용자가 로그오프한 후에도 계속될 수 있는 장기 실행 작업이 가능합니다. 이는 SageMaker AI의 신뢰할 수 있는 자격 증명 전파를 통해 활성화할 수 있습니다. 다음 페이지에서는 사용자 백그라운드 세션의 구성 옵션과 동작을 설명합니다.
참고
신뢰할 수 있는 자격 증명 전파가 활성화된 경우 기존 활성 사용자 세션은 영향을 받지 않습니다. 기본 기간은 새 사용자 세션 또는 다시 시작된 세션에만 적용됩니다.
주제
사용자 백그라운드 세션 구성
Amazon SageMaker Studio에 대해 신뢰할 수 있는 자격 증명 전파가 활성화되면 IAM Identity Center의 사용자 백그라운드 세션을 통해 기본 기간 제한을 구성할 수 있습니다.
기본 사용자 백그라운드 세션 기간
기본적으로 모든 사용자 백그라운드 세션의 기간 제한은 7일입니다. 관리자는 IAM Identity Center 콘솔에서이 기간을 수정할 수 있습니다. 이 설정은 Identity Center 인스턴스 수준에서 적용되며 해당 인스턴스 내에서 지원되는 모든 IAM Identity Center 애플리케이션 및 Studio 도메인에 영향을 줍니다.
신뢰할 수 있는 자격 증명 전파가 활성화되면 SageMaker AI 콘솔의 관리자가 다음 정보가 포함된 배너를 찾습니다.
-
사용자 백그라운드 세션의 기간 제한
-
관리자가이 구성을 변경할 수 있는 Identity Center 콘솔에 대한 링크
-
기간은 15분에서 최대 90일까지 임의의 값으로 설정할 수 있습니다.
-
사용자 백그라운드 세션이 만료되면 오류 메시지가 표시됩니다. Identity Center 콘솔 링크를 사용하여 기간을 업데이트할 수 있습니다.
Studio에서 신뢰할 수 있는 자격 증명 전파 비활성화의 영향
관리자가 신뢰할 수 있는 자격 증명 전파를 처음 활성화한 후 SageMaker AI 콘솔에서 비활성화하는 경우:
-
사용자 백그라운드 세션이 활성화된 경우 기존 작업은 중단 없이 계속 실행됩니다.
-
사용자 백그라운드 세션이 비활성화되면 장기 실행 중인 SageMaker AI 워크플로 또는 영구 상태의 작업은 대화형 세션 사용으로 전환됩니다. 여기에는 실행 상태를 유지하거나 지속적인 모니터링이 필요한 SageMaker AI 리소스가 포함되지만 이에 국한되지 않습니다. 예: SageMaker AI 훈련 및 처리 작업.
-
사용자는 체크포인트에서 만료된 작업을 다시 시작할 수 있습니다.
-
새 작업은 IAM 역할 자격 증명으로 실행되며 자격 증명 컨텍스트를 전파하지 않습니다.
Identity Center 콘솔에서 사용자 백그라운드 세션 비활성화의 영향
관리자가 IAM Identity Center 콘솔에서 신뢰할 수 있는 ID 전파를 활성화하지만 사용자 백그라운드 세션을 비활성화하는 경우:
-
사용자가 로그인한 상태로 있으면 백그라운드 세션 중에 생성된 훈련 작업이 대화형 세션으로 대체되지 않습니다.
-
사용자가 로그오프하면 세션이 만료되고 대화형 세션에 따라 훈련 작업이 실패합니다.
-
사용자는 마지막 체크포인트에서 훈련 작업을 다시 시작할 수 있습니다. 세션 기간은 IAM Identity Center 콘솔에서 대화형 세션 기간에 대해 설정된 항목에 따라 결정됩니다.
-
훈련 및 파이프라인과 같은 서비스는 워크플로에서 대화형 세션을 사용하는 것으로 돌아갑니다.
-
SageMaker AI는 CreateTrainingJob 요청을 거부하지 않고 대화형 세션으로 처리합니다.
-
사용자가 작업을 시작한 후 백그라운드 세션을 비활성화하면 작업은 기존 백그라운드 세션을 계속 사용합니다. 즉, SageMaker AI는 새 백그라운드 세션을 생성하지 않습니다.
Identity Center 인스턴스 수준에서 백그라운드 세션이 활성화되었지만 IAM Identity Center APIs를 사용하는 Studio 애플리케이션에 대해 특별히 비활성화된 경우에도 동일한 동작이 적용됩니다.
런타임 고려 사항
관리자가 사용자 백그라운드 세션 기간보다 낮은 장기 실행 훈련 또는 처리 작업을 MaxRuntimeInSeconds
설정하면 SageMaker AI는 최소 MaxRuntimeInSeconds
또는 사용자 백그라운드 세션 기간 동안 작업을 실행합니다. 에 대한 자세한 내용은 CreateTrainingJob을 MaxRuntimeInSeconds
참조하세요. 런타임 설정 방법에 대한 자세한 내용은 IAM Identity Center의 사용자 백그라운드 세션을 참조하세요.
세션 동작 요약
IAM Identity Center 인스턴스에 대해 사용자 백그라운드 세션이 비활성화되면 SageMaker AI 작업은 사용자 대화형 세션을 사용합니다. 대화형 세션을 사용하는 경우 다음과 같은 경우 SageMaker AI 작업이 15분 이내에 실패합니다.
-
사용자가 로그아웃합니다.
-
관리자가 대화형 세션을 취소합니다.
IAM Identity Center 인스턴스에 대해 사용자 백그라운드 세션이 활성화되면 SageMaker AI 작업은 사용자 백그라운드 세션을 사용합니다. 대화형 세션을 사용하는 경우 다음과 같은 경우 SageMaker AI 작업이 15분 이내에 실패합니다.
-
사용자 백그라운드 세션이 만료됩니다.
-
관리자가 사용자 백그라운드 세션을 수동으로 취소합니다.